Should you be buying Tecnoglass stock or one of its competitors? The main competitors of Tecnoglass include Cemex (CX), James Hardie Industries (JHX), Eagle Materials (EXP), Fortune Brands Innovations (FBIN), West Fraser Timber (WFG), Arcosa (ACA), Champion Homes (SKY), United States Lime & Minerals (USLM), Crane NXT (CXT), and Hillman Solutions (HLMN). These companies are all part of the "construction materials" industry.

Tecnoglass (NYSE:TGLS) and Cemex (NYSE:CX) are both construction companies, but which is the superior business? We will contrast the two companies based on the strength of their risk, media sentiment, dividends, profitability, analyst recommendations, valuation, institutional ownership and earnings.

37.4% of Tecnoglass shares are held by institutional investors. Comparatively, 83.0% of Cemex shares are held by institutional investors. 0.3% of Tecnoglass shares are held by company insiders. Comparatively, 1.0% of Cemex shares are held by company ins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that hedge funds, endowments and large money managers believe a stock is poised for long-term growth.

Cemex has higher revenue and earnings than Tecnoglass. Cemex is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Tecnoglass,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.

Tecnoglass has a net margin of 19.13% compared to Cemex's net margin of 9.61%. Tecnoglass' return on equity of 28.77% beat Cemex's return on equity.

Tecnoglass has a beta of 1.87, suggesting that its stock price is 87%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Cemex has a beta of 1.43, suggesting that its stock price is 43% more volatile than the S&P 500.

Cemex has a consensus price target of $8.53, indicating a potential downside of 6.06%. Given Cemex's stronger consensus rating and higher probable upside, analysts plainly believe Cemex is more favorable than Tecnoglass.

Tecnoglass pays an annual dividend of $0.60 per share and has a dividend yield of 0.8%. Cemex pays an annual dividend of $0.08 per share and has a dividend yield of 0.9%. Tecnoglass pays out 15.4%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Cemex pays out 7.8%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Both companies have healthy payout ratios and should be able to cover their dividend payments with earnings for the next several years. Cemex is clearly the better dividend stock, given its higher yield and lower payout ratio.

Summary

Cemex beats Tecnoglass on 11 of the 18 factors compared between the two stocks.
